AI agents use create_market to commit financial operations through Question Market — usually the final step of a payment, billing, or trading workflow. A call moves real money.
Creating a prediction market on a blockchain-based trading platform constitutes committing a financial obligation. It deploys a smart contract that enables real financial trading activity, involves on-chain transactions with cryptocurrency (Algorand), and establishes binding market rules.

It is categorised as a Financial tool in the Question Market MCP Server, which means it involves financial transactions. Block by default and require explicit approval.
Register the Question Market MCP server in PolicyLayer and add a rule for create_market: allow, deny, rate-limit, or require approval. Point your MCP client at the PolicyLayer proxy URL and the rule is enforced on every call, before it reaches Question Market. Nothing to install.
create_market is a Financial tool with critical risk. Critical-risk tools should be blocked by default and only enabled with explicit human approval.
Yes. Add a rate_limit block to the create_market rule in your PolicyLayer policy. For example, setting max: 10 and window: 60 limits the tool to 10 calls per minute. Rate limits are tracked per agent session and reset automatically.
Set action: deny in the PolicyLayer policy for create_market. The AI agent will receive a policy violation error and cannot call the tool. You can also include a reason field to explain why the tool is blocked.
create_market is provided by the Question Market MCP server (qmrkt/mcp-server). PolicyLayer sits as a proxy in front of this server to enforce policies before tool calls reach the server.
